"On The Blockade" is a captivating novel written by author Oliver Optic that tells the gripping tale of a young boy named Christy Passford who finds himself on a thrilling adventure during the American Civil War. Set against the backdrop of naval warfare, this coming-of-age story follows Christy as he joins the Union navy as a midshipman on board the Cumberland. As he navigates the challenges of life at sea, Christy proves himself to be a brave and resourceful sailor, facing danger and adversity with courage and determination.

Filled with action, suspense, and camaraderie, "On The Blockade" is a compelling read that will captivate readers of all ages. Oliver Optic's vivid storytelling brings to life the realities of war and the indomitable spirit of the human heart.
